]> git.friedersdorff.com Git - max/saltfiles.git/blobdiff - states/i3/init.sls
Suspend on inactivity?
[max/saltfiles.git] / states / i3 / init.sls
index 4f09c0f95318a160782ff2a4d03235856d453cc5..71318218db6ab104bdc317a2bc1baf7fdbec29ea 100644 (file)
@@ -37,3 +37,45 @@ conky launch script:
     - user: {{ grains['user'] }}
     - group: {{ grains['user'] }}
     - mode: 750
+
+layout colemak gb:
+  file.managed:
+    - name: {{ grains['homedir'] }}/.local/bin/layout-colemak_gb
+    - source: salt://i3/files/layout-colemak_gb
+    - user: {{ grains['user'] }}
+    - group: {{ grains['user'] }}
+    - mode: 750
+
+layout colemak us:
+  file.managed:
+    - name: {{ grains['homedir'] }}/.local/bin/layout-colemak_us
+    - source: salt://i3/files/layout-colemak_us
+    - user: {{ grains['user'] }}
+    - group: {{ grains['user'] }}
+    - mode: 750
+
+layout us:
+  file.managed:
+    - name: {{ grains['homedir'] }}/.local/bin/layout-qwerty_us
+    - source: salt://i3/files/layout-qwerty_us
+    - user: {{ grains['user'] }}
+    - group: {{ grains['user'] }}
+    - mode: 750
+
+xprofile config:
+  file.managed:
+    - name: {{ grains['homedir'] }}/.xprofile
+    - source: salt://i3/files/xprofile.jinja
+    - template: jinja
+    - user: {{ grains['user']}}
+    - group: {{ grains['user']}}
+    - mode: 640
+
+xinitrc config:
+  file.managed:
+    - name: {{ grains['homedir'] }}/.xinitrc
+    - source: salt://i3/files/xinitrc.jinja
+    - template: jinja
+    - user: {{ grains['user']}}
+    - group: {{ grains['user']}}
+    - mode: 640